CURRENT STATUS OF EDUCATION INFORMATIZATION
• Statistics show that IT investment in 2006
30.48 billion yuan for education
68% for H/W
More than 2000 people elected school syllabus, credit recognition, sharing
of resources.
• China Education and Research Network covers
31 provinces, municipalities and autonomous regions of more than 200
cities, networking universities, teaching institutions.
 And the various colleges and universities have set up their own campus
network, digital libraries, and other modern educational information
infrastructure.
 For basic education, "School Link" project will also be information of the
level of primary and secondary education to a new level.
 So far the construction of educational information initially completed, but
still can not meet the requirements of the development of education in
China
 There are still some problems
Infrastructure fast speed and application lags behindc
large investment in hardware environment of low output and effect of
application on present educational information is the principal issue in the
development process.
The present campus network is still in a idle state and does not take full
advantage of the available resources.
Information technology in education only exists as a presentation tool.
The impact on education is not up to expectations.
Education and information resources, including electronic audio-visual materials, media
materials, courseware, case studies, literature, exam, teaching tools, and many types.
China's education software is often from a single subject, single-function design point of
view, resulting in operational difficulties and the problem of incompatible resources.
There is no effective management system. large number of high-quality courseware,
resources and materials are distributed in individual well-known schools, the hands of
the famous teachers, and more local institutions
lack of resources And other conditions. Educational information so gradually widening
the gap.
The lack and the imbalance of educational resources
Updated slowly and sharing at a low level
With the rapid development of various technologies:-
competition for jobs tend to require schools to provide students with
new laboratories, computer equipment and creation of related new
courses to improve skills of students to meet the new situation.
The current network speed, Internet access charges and other causes
can not keep up in the form of the development of resource sharing.
The Application Of Cloud Computing in Education
Informatization
• Cloud computing applications in the education will be the future of information technology
infrastructure of education.
• Integration of these resources by way of cloud computing will be able to meet the massive
demand for high speed processing of data
• China has now started the education program of cloud computing
• In this partnership, Google to provide course materials to the finishing professor at
Tsinghua University, Tsinghua University, provided laboratory equipment and to assistance
of resources in the building of cloud computing research environment.
A. Learning under the network environment
• Modern education theories think that the students who should be the
main body of teaching are not passive but initiative.
• The learner according to the type of cloud services, free choice learning
content and learning methods.
• The basic elements of personal learning environment such as
text,audio,and video training.
• We just need to connect through the browser easily and freely to create
personalized learning environment for virtual classrooms on-site.
B. Application of SAAS in Education Informatization:
• School access these cloud computing services, no longer need to spend a lot of
money to buy commercial software license, the burden of frequent upgrades and
maintenance costs.
•The client's local computer simply run the graphical interface of the any operating
system(linux) and Browser(firefox)
• Do not worry about whether the latest version of application software, which greatly
reduces maintenance and upgrade schools operating system and application software
costs
